Arrow, The Flash, Supergirl and Legends of Tomorrow have done a series of 3 to 4 episodes, one episode from each show for the last 3 seasons where they are in their own mini-3 to 4 episodes each, interweaving into each other and all assist each other.
Look for the DC, Look for episodes titled, Legends of Today & Legends of Tomorrow. Invasion, Crisis on Earth-X, Elseworlds. They are all 3 to 4 episodes each. Each episode is part of each shows seasons, except for Legends or Supergirl, I forgot. one of the series were only in the 2nd and 3rd set.
With the Arrow, it starts in S4, Episodes 7 & 8. In S5, E8, the 100th episode, Invasion. Then S6, E8 Crisis on Earth-X. Then S7, E9, Elseworld.
For the Flash, it starts with S2, E7 & 8. In S3, E8, it starts with; Invasion. S4, E8, Crisis on Earth-X, Part 3. And S5, E9, Elseworlds: Part 1
For Legends of Tomorrow S2, E7, Invasion. S3, E8, Crisis on Earth=X; Part 4. I think Legends' Elseworlds comes out in the fall.
For Supergirl, S3, E8, Crisis on Earth=X, Part 1. S4, E9, Elseworlds; Part 3.
